--- oup/current/FileClasses/TXMP.pas 2007/06/12 20:31:54 215 +++ oup/current/FileClasses/TXMP.pas 2007/06/28 09:24:08 232 @@ -9,12 +9,14 @@ type TFile_TXMP = class(TFile) public procedure InitDataFields; override; + procedure InitEditor; override; end; implementation uses - ConnectionManager, Math, Classes, TypeDefs, _DataTypes; + ConnectionManager, Math, Classes, TypeDefs, _DataTypes, ExtCtrls, StdCtrls, + Controls, Forms; { TFile_TXMP } @@ -105,5 +107,33 @@ begin end; +procedure TFile_TXMP.InitEditor; +var + group: TGroupBox; + splitter: TSplitter; +begin + inherited; + FEditor := TFrame.Create(nil); + group := TGroupBox.Create(FEditor); + group.Align := alTop; + group.Height := 150; + group.Caption := '1. '; + group.Parent := FEditor; + + splitter := TSplitter.Create(FEditor); + splitter.Align := alTop; + splitter.Top := group.Height + 10; + splitter.AutoSnap := False; + splitter.MinSize := 100; + splitter.Beveled := True; + splitter.Height := 8; + splitter.Parent := FEditor; + + group := TGroupBox.Create(FEditor); + group.Align := alClient; + group.Caption := '2. '; + group.Parent := FEditor; +end; + end.